Somerville's 311 Service Marks 20 Years of Connecting the Community with City Hall

From a few people and a phone line to a thriving customer service center, the region’s first 311 Center is still going strong

During the week of March 11, the City of Somerville is not only celebrating National 3-1-1 Day, it is marking the 20th anniversary of it’s 311 Constituent Services Office. The first 311 service to be established in the region, Somerville’s 311 team works year-round, around the clock, and through every storm to connect the Somerville community to City Hall and its services.

Somerville PorchFest 2025: Important Safety & Event Updates

The Somerville Arts Council is excited to announce PorchFest 2025, the citywide live music event, is returning on Saturday, May 10, from 12 to 6 p.m. (rain date: Sunday, May 11). 

To ensure a safe, enjoyable, and well-organized experience for all, this year’s event will feature new safety measures and structural updates designed to enhance the day for both performers and residents. All information is available on somervilleartscouncil.org/porchfest

 

Somerville Class of 2025 Invited to Apply for Municipal Scholarship Opportunity

Seven scholarships available to Somerville residents currently graduating in the Class of 2025. Application Period closes March 31, 2025

Mayor Katjana Ballantyne and the City of Somerville Municipal Scholarship Committee are reminding Somerville residents graduating high school in 2025 to apply now for seven municipal scholarship opportunities. Selected applicants will receive $1,000 to help with post-secondary education expenses.
